Granule loss on asphalt shingles is the #1 indicator of remaining roof life — and it's epidemic in Blaine after the 2017, 2019, 2020, and 2024 hailstorms. Granules protect the asphalt mat from UV; once they're gone, the mat dries, cracks, and fails within 12-24 months.

Storm damage causes acute granule loss in distinctive patterns (impact bruising, exposed mat at strike points). Age-related granule loss is uniform and gradual. Drone aerial documentation lets us count strikes per square — most insurance carriers require 8+ strikes per 100 sq ft to fund a full replacement.
